About the role

  • Implementation, Upgrades, Support & Troubleshooting
  • Hands-on experience with cloud networking, Palo Alto firewalls in Azure & AWS, and segmentation platforms such as Illumio Core/Cloud and Guardicore (Akamai Segmentation)
  • Implement and maintain micro-segmentation policies, including application dependency mapping, rule-set creation, and enforcement across hybrid workloads
  • Experience designing and supporting segmentation architectures to enhance security posture and reduce lateral movement risks
  • Strong understanding of zero-trust network segmentation principles and how they apply to enterprise network security
  • Extensive experience implementing and maintaining firewalls and staying updated on newly released security vulnerabilities and their impact on the network
  • Perform ongoing optimization of network security devices and segmentation platforms to ensure adequate capacity, availability, and scalability
  • Implement, troubleshoot, and document network security infrastructures and segmentation deployments, including policy testing, traffic flows, and enforcement validation
  • Expertise in modifying firewall rule sets, segmentation rules, changing security policies, whitelisting, content filtering, and troubleshooting traffic flows across firewalls, segmentation tools, routers, and switches
  • Strong knowledge of Layer 4–7 app-aware firewalls and micro-segmentation traffic policies
  • Establish and modify site-to-site VPNs and secure connectivity paths for segmented workloads
  • Manage threat protection, URL blocking, IOC feeds, routers, switches, segmentation policies, and endpoint enforcement controls
  • Periodically monitor firewall and segmentation agent health, performance, and capacity across global environments
  • Participate in Change Management processes, including creating change requests, performing peer reviews, validating segmentation change impact, and executing firewall or segmentation modifications
  • Develop detailed build and test plans for implementing firewalls and segmentation deployments
  • Coordinate with IT teams to ensure standardized network and segmentation configurations, control frameworks, and enforcement practices
  • Recommend enhancements to improve network reliability, segmentation accuracy, security posture, and operational performance
  • Collaborate globally with IT teams—security, cloud, data center, and application teams—to resolve issues and ensure network/segmentation alignment
  • Define reusable network and micro-segmentation patterns for branch, data center, and cloud environments
  • Document segmentation deployments, firewall standards, policy frameworks, and configuration baselines
  • Experience with network automation tools such as Ansible, Terraform, Python (e.g., automating policy pushes, firewall rules, segmentation updates)
  • Wireless network design, support, and troubleshooting
  • Understanding of TCP/IP Stack, AD, DNS, DHCP, Routing (BGP, OSPF, VXLAN), and east-west traffic considerations for segmentation
  • Participate in disaster recovery exercises, including validating segmented application recovery paths and connectivity requirements
  • Resolve escalations for complex technical problems involving firewalls, segmentation agents, cloud networking, and hybrid routing
  • Participate in incident management and problem resolution for global network and segmentation issues
  • Design and implement cloud network architectures using best practices, incorporating segmentation and zero-trust principles
  • Deploy and troubleshoot firewall based decryption of HTTPS traffic
  • Integration of cloud networking environments into global corporate network using direct connections, SDWAN, and security architectures
  • Troubleshoot application traffic flows with application developers through complex multi-cloud environments
  • Design, implement, deploy, and troubleshoot IPsec VPNs.
